Abstract. In management games, players enjoy developing the virtual
objects, such as avatars, farms, villages, cities, resources, etc. Usually,
the management games do not have a time limit to play. Players know
little about how much time that they need to devote in order to quickly
build up the virtual objects. This paper studies about the diculty level
of the management games. That is, under a limit amount of time, how far
a player can develop the objects. We propose to adopt a neural network
to evaluate the diculty of such kind of games. There is a diverse set of
features supported by management games. Thus, we have developed a
manageable management game called Wonders of Seabed. Our game is
a 3D game and the game story happens at the seabed. Players need to
develop a city by managing different resources. Our method can adjust
the game diculty for the players.

1 Introduction
Games are useful for people to learn knowledge and they are widely used for
educational and training purposes [2][6]. Serious games are also considered for
healthcare training [7]. Management games enable players to acquire knowledge
and they have educational purposes. Management games have become popular
since SimCity. Management games enable players to develop the virtual farms,
cities and other virtual items. Players can create any items supported in the
games and gradually upgrade the items. The players have fun by organizing and
beautifying the virtual items in the game. However, management games could
be time consuming and tedious to play. It would take a long time to collect the
required items.
